Vendor will comply with the following Code of Conduct:
- Vendor may not engage in any action or practice in violation of the laws or regulations of any country or other location in which it does business. This includes, but is not limited to, laws and regulations related to labor, immigration, health and safety, working hours, and the environment.
- Child, indentured, involuntary, or prison labor must not be used or supported.
- Workers may not be exposed to unreasonably hazardous, unsafe, or unhealthy conditions.
- Workers may not be unlawfully discriminated against on the basis of race, color, religion, gender, national origin, age, disability or sexual orientation.
- Workplace must be free from harassment, which includes coercive, threatening, abusive, or exploitive conduct or behavior or harassment because of one’s race, color, religion, gender, national origin, age, disability or sexual orientation.
- Workers at all times must be treated fairly, with dignity and respect. Vendor will not prevent workers from choosing to associate (or not) with any group or bargaining collectively (or not), consistent with applicable laws.
- Wages paid to workers must meet or exceed legal and industry standards.
- All workers performing work within the United States must be legally authorized to work in the United States under federal and any other applicable laws. Prior to each worker’s assignment, Vendor must require and review documentation proving such work authorization.
- Vendor may not engage in any conduct likely, intending, or appearing to improperly influence any Nutrawise representatives in the performance of their job responsibilities. Bribes, cash payments, and business gifts and entertainment of more than token value expressly are prohibited. Vendor must refrain from engaging in any conduct that may appear improper or may result in a conflict of interest when viewed from Nutrawise’s point of view.
- Vendor must comply with the provisions of the U.S. Foreign Corrupt Practices Act of 1977, as amended. Vendor will not offer or provide money or anything else of value to any agent or representative of any government or government agency in order to obtain or retain business.
- Vendor will act with reasonable diligence to ensure that any of its contractors, subcontractors, manufacturing facilities, labor providers, agents, agencies, associations, distributors, partner organizations, suppliers, affiliated companies, or subsidiaries who are involved in Nutrawise business, also comply with this Code of Conduct.
- Vendor will allow Nutrawise, or a third party auditor selected by Nutrawise to audit Vendor’s compliance with this Code of Conduct.
